Laptop for me and I use it in the kitchen. It's kinda hard to have an office when you live in a flat. I can't write with my pc or tele in my bedroom, I'm too easily distracted. Honestly, I'd like to disconnect the laptop from the internet as well but I can't as no-one else would be able to use it.

I tend to write with the kitchen door shut as well. I prefer the quiet.

I can't write longhand either, as I can't for some reason get my thought processes down too well. It's quite problematic when I need to write something in creative writing class and I have like five minutes. In fact, the last piece I wrote there, needed to be wrote in skaz (if anyone's heard of that?). It was quite funny, I intended to use scribbled out words and I couldn't read my writing when I came to read it out. It didn't help that many of the words used were either abbreviated or slang.

That's one thing I hate about longhand writing actually. It becomes a mess when you're scribbling words out.
